AIIMS Bachelor of Optometry is an undergraduate course. It is one of the paramedical courses with a course duration of 4 years. Admission to this course is through the national entrance exam conducted by AIIMS. Candidate must have passed/appeared in 10+2 or equivalent examination with English Physics Chemistry and either Biology or Mathematics & has a minimum mark 50% for Gen/ EWS/OBC and 45% in case of SCs/ STs Categories in aggregate in English Physics Chemistry and either Biology or Mathematics (as applicable) of qualifying examination I. e 10+2 or equivalent. Candidate age should be 17 year as on the 31st of December,2022.

The optometry specialization deals with eye care. This domain specialist is responsible for the examination of visual issues and for suggesting spectacles or contact lenses for vision correction.
1. You will study subjects such as Human Anatomy, Refraction, Investigative Ophthalmology, Ophthalmic Instruments and Appliances, Refraction and Contact Lenses, Ophthalmic Theater Techniques, etc.
2. These subjects are divided into six semesters and taught as theory and lab practice for three years.
3. After which you will have one year of clinical experience in any eye care institution or hospital.
